Как действует кодирование информации
Как действует кодирование информации
Шифрование данных является собой процесс конвертации данных в нечитаемый формы. Исходный текст зовётся незашифрованным, а закодированный — шифротекстом. Конвертация осуществляется с помощью алгоритма и ключа. Ключ является собой уникальную последовательность символов.
Механизм шифрования стартует с использования вычислительных вычислений к информации. Алгоритм изменяет организацию информации согласно установленным принципам. Результат делается бесполезным сочетанием знаков казино онлайн для постороннего зрителя. Расшифровка реализуема только при наличии правильного ключа.
Современные системы безопасности задействуют сложные вычислительные функции. Скомпрометировать надёжное шифрование без ключа фактически невозможно. Технология охраняет переписку, финансовые транзакции и личные документы клиентов.
Что такое криптография и зачем она необходима
Криптография представляет собой дисциплину о способах защиты информации от несанкционированного доступа. Дисциплина рассматривает приёмы разработки алгоритмов для обеспечения приватности сведений. Криптографические приёмы используются для разрешения проблем защиты в виртуальной пространстве.
Главная цель криптографии заключается в охране конфиденциальности сообщений при передаче по открытым каналам. Технология обеспечивает, что только авторизованные адресаты смогут прочесть содержимое. Криптография также гарантирует неизменность информации казино онлайн и подтверждает аутентичность источника.
Нынешний электронный пространство невозможен без шифровальных решений. Финансовые операции требуют надёжной защиты финансовых информации пользователей. Цифровая почта нуждается в шифровке для сохранения конфиденциальности. Виртуальные хранилища применяют криптографию для безопасности файлов.
Криптография решает задачу аутентификации сторон коммуникации. Технология даёт удостовериться в подлинности собеседника или отправителя сообщения. Электронные подписи основаны на криптографических основах и имеют юридической силой казино онлайн во многих странах.
Защита личных информации стала крайне важной проблемой для организаций. Криптография предотвращает кражу личной информации преступниками. Технология обеспечивает безопасность врачебных данных и деловой тайны компаний.
Основные виды кодирования
Существует два главных типа шифрования: симметричное и асимметричное. Симметричное кодирование задействует единый ключ для шифрования и расшифровки информации. Источник и получатель должны знать идентичный тайный ключ.
Симметричные алгоритмы функционируют оперативно и результативно обрабатывают значительные массивы данных. Главная трудность состоит в безопасной передаче ключа между участниками. Если злоумышленник перехватит ключ Бездепозитное казино во время передачи, защита будет скомпрометирована.
Асимметричное кодирование задействует пару вычислительно взаимосвязанных ключей. Публичный ключ применяется для кодирования данных и доступен всем. Приватный ключ используется для дешифровки и хранится в секрете.
Достоинство асимметрической криптографии заключается в отсутствии потребности передавать тайный ключ. Отправитель кодирует сообщение открытым ключом адресата. Декодировать данные может только обладатель соответствующего закрытого ключа казино онлайн из пары.
Гибридные системы совмещают два метода для достижения максимальной эффективности. Асимметричное шифрование используется для безопасного обмена симметрическим ключом. Далее симметрический алгоритм обрабатывает главный объём данных благодаря большой производительности.
Подбор типа зависит от критериев безопасности и эффективности. Каждый метод имеет уникальными характеристиками и областями использования.
Сравнение симметрического и асимметричного шифрования
Симметрическое шифрование отличается большой производительностью обработки данных. Алгоритмы нуждаются минимальных процессорных мощностей для шифрования крупных файлов. Способ подходит для защиты данных на накопителях и в хранилищах.
Асимметрическое шифрование функционирует медленнее из-за комплексных вычислительных вычислений. Вычислительная нагрузка увеличивается при росте объёма информации. Технология используется для передачи небольших объёмов крайне значимой данных Бездепозитное казино между пользователями.
Управление ключами является основное отличие между методами. Симметрические системы требуют защищённого соединения для отправки секретного ключа. Асимметрические способы разрешают проблему через публикацию публичных ключей.
Размер ключа воздействует на уровень безопасности системы. Симметрические алгоритмы используют ключи длиной 128-256 бит. Асимметрическое шифрование нуждается ключи длиной 2048-4096 бит онлайн казино для аналогичной надёжности.
Расширяемость различается в зависимости от числа участников. Симметричное шифрование требует индивидуального ключа для каждой пары участников. Асимметрический подход позволяет использовать единую комплект ключей для общения со всеми.
Как работает SSL/TLS безопасность
SSL и TLS являются собой стандарты криптографической безопасности для защищённой отправки данных в сети. TLS является актуальной версией устаревшего протокола SSL. Технология обеспечивает конфиденциальность и неизменность данных между пользователем и сервером.
Процесс установления защищённого подключения начинается с рукопожатия между сторонами. Клиент посылает требование на соединение и принимает сертификат от сервера. Сертификат содержит открытый ключ и информацию о обладателе ресурса Бездепозитное казино для проверки подлинности.
Браузер верифицирует достоверность сертификата через цепочку доверенных центров сертификации. Проверка удостоверяет, что сервер действительно принадлежит заявленному владельцу. После удачной валидации начинается передача шифровальными настройками для формирования защищённого канала.
Стороны согласовывают симметричный ключ сеанса с помощью асимметричного кодирования. Клиент генерирует произвольный ключ и шифрует его открытым ключом сервера. Только сервер может декодировать данные своим приватным ключом онлайн казино и извлечь ключ сеанса.
Последующий передача данными происходит с использованием симметричного кодирования и определённого ключа. Такой метод обеспечивает высокую производительность передачи информации при поддержании защиты. Стандарт охраняет онлайн-платежи, аутентификацию клиентов и приватную коммуникацию в интернете.
Алгоритмы кодирования данных
Криптографические алгоритмы являются собой вычислительные методы трансформации информации для гарантирования защиты. Разные алгоритмы используются в зависимости от критериев к скорости и безопасности.
- AES является стандартом симметрического кодирования и применяется правительственными учреждениями. Алгоритм поддерживает ключи размером 128, 192 и 256 бит для различных степеней защиты механизмов.
- RSA является собой асимметрический алгоритм, базирующийся на сложности факторизации крупных чисел. Метод применяется для цифровых подписей и защищённого передачи ключами.
- SHA-256 принадлежит к семейству хеш-функций и формирует уникальный хеш данных фиксированной размера. Алгоритм применяется для верификации неизменности документов и хранения паролей.
- ChaCha20 является актуальным поточным шифром с высокой эффективностью на портативных гаджетах. Алгоритм гарантирует качественную защиту при небольшом потреблении ресурсов.
Подбор алгоритма определяется от специфики задачи и требований защиты программы. Сочетание методов повышает уровень безопасности системы.
Где применяется шифрование
Банковский сектор применяет шифрование для охраны финансовых операций клиентов. Онлайн-платежи осуществляются через безопасные каналы с использованием актуальных алгоритмов. Платёжные карты включают закодированные данные для предотвращения мошенничества.
Мессенджеры применяют сквозное кодирование для гарантирования конфиденциальности общения. Сообщения кодируются на устройстве отправителя и расшифровываются только у получателя. Операторы не имеют доступа к содержанию общения казино онлайн благодаря безопасности.
Цифровая корреспонденция применяет стандарты шифрования для защищённой отправки писем. Корпоративные решения защищают секретную деловую данные от перехвата. Технология пресекает чтение сообщений посторонними лицами.
Виртуальные сервисы шифруют документы пользователей для охраны от утечек. Файлы кодируются перед отправкой на серверы провайдера. Доступ обретает только обладатель с корректным ключом.
Медицинские учреждения используют криптографию для охраны цифровых записей больных. Кодирование предотвращает несанкционированный доступ к врачебной данным.
Риски и слабости механизмов кодирования
Слабые пароли представляют значительную угрозу для шифровальных механизмов безопасности. Пользователи устанавливают простые сочетания символов, которые просто угадываются злоумышленниками. Нападения перебором компрометируют надёжные алгоритмы при предсказуемых ключах.
Недочёты в реализации протоколов формируют уязвимости в защите данных. Программисты допускают уязвимости при создании программы кодирования. Некорректная настройка настроек уменьшает результативность онлайн казино системы безопасности.
Атаки по побочным каналам дают извлекать секретные ключи без непосредственного взлома. Злоумышленники анализируют длительность выполнения вычислений, потребление или электромагнитное излучение прибора. Физический доступ к технике увеличивает риски компрометации.
Квантовые компьютеры представляют потенциальную опасность для асимметрических алгоритмов. Процессорная мощность квантовых компьютеров способна взломать RSA и другие способы. Научное сообщество создаёт постквантовые алгоритмы для противодействия угрозам.
Социальная инженерия обходит технологические средства через манипулирование пользователями. Злоумышленники обретают проникновение к ключам посредством мошенничества пользователей. Людской фактор остаётся слабым местом защиты.
Перспективы криптографических решений
Квантовая криптография открывает возможности для абсолютно безопасной передачи данных. Технология базируется на основах квантовой механики. Любая попытка перехвата меняет состояние квантовых частиц и обнаруживается системой.
Постквантовые алгоритмы разрабатываются для защиты от перспективных квантовых компьютеров. Математические методы создаются с учётом вычислительных способностей квантовых компьютеров. Компании внедряют новые нормы для длительной защиты.
Гомоморфное кодирование даёт выполнять вычисления над закодированными информацией без декодирования. Технология решает проблему обслуживания конфиденциальной информации в виртуальных сервисах. Результаты остаются защищёнными на протяжении всего процесса Бездепозитное казино обслуживания.
Блокчейн-технологии внедряют шифровальные методы для децентрализованных систем хранения. Электронные подписи обеспечивают неизменность данных в цепочке блоков. Децентрализованная структура увеличивает устойчивость механизмов.
Искусственный интеллект применяется для исследования протоколов и поиска слабостей. Машинное обучение помогает создавать надёжные алгоритмы шифрования.